The NHL released the full schedule for its two conference finals series, and this time we get to make definitive plans rather than have a bunch of “TBD” and “could be noon, could be 3:00, could be 8:00” games.
Here are the game days, dates and times (all Eastern Daylight Time), with North American TV coverage for the New York Islanders and Tampa Bay Lightning in the Eastern Conference Final. It’s a nice, every-other-day schedule, with only one matinee, on Sunday for Game 4.
U.S. fans will want to note that Friday’s Game 3 is on USA Network:
- Monday, Sept. 7, 8 p.m.: Islanders vs. Lightning | NBCSN, CBC, SN, TVAS
- Wednesday, Sept. 9, 8 p.m.: Islanders vs. Lightning | NBCSN, CBC, TVAS
- Friday, Sept. 11, 8 p.m.: Lightning vs. Islanders | USA, CBC, SN TVAS
- Sunday, Sept. 13, 3 p.m.: Lightning vs. Islanders | NBC, CBC, SN, TVAS
- *Tuesday, Sept. 15, 8 p.m.: Islanders vs. Lightning | NBCSN, CBC, SN, TVAS
- *Thursday, Sept. 17, 8 p.m.: Lightning vs. Islanders | NBCSN, CBC, SN, TVAS
- *Saturday, Sept. 19, 7:30 p.m.: Islanders vs. Lightning | NBC, CBC, SN, TVAS
For this series the Islanders and Lightning have left the Toronto “bubble” (thanks for all the playoff wins, Toronto!) and headed to the Western bubble in Edmonton, where the rest of the playoffs will take place.
